#b639d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b639d2 is composed of 71.4% red, 22.4%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.3% cyan, 72.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 289 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 52.4%. #b639d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ff72ff with #6d00a5.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#b639d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08020a is the darkest color, while #fdf9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b639d2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878487 is the less saturated color, while #ce14f7 is the most saturated one.
